GBTC issued for 11k+ btc in shares for their investors on Friday. Since the start of issuing new shares (2 weeks ago) they have added 19k+ btc to their holdings. They hold 258k btc now.

HOLD!

grayscale.co

https://twitter.com/GrayscaleInvest
Quote
N.B. At end of 2018, it had 204k btc only. In ten months, they've added 53k.
